Bori said:   1 decade ago
Dynamic friction:- friction offered by the body when it is moving.

Static friction:- friction offered by the body when it is in steady.

When the body is moving as compared to steady state it offers less friction than the steady state.

Therefore D is not the answer.

And in other C option when potential energy is converted into kinetic energy experience certain friction on the surface.

Both C and D both are not correct answer.
